Output f8c33b26378041fcf0582f3733f2c8977ad0c41f5936ab62826f26c1e66f908e:54

value
10710590
script pubkey
OP_0 OP_PUSHBYTES_20 5bf77853ff0bd7cab48e78defc26eed57d2d5de3
address
bc1qt0mhs5llp0tu4dyw0r00cfhw647j6h0rx6tqln
transaction
f8c33b26378041fcf0582f3733f2c8977ad0c41f5936ab62826f26c1e66f908e
spent
true